Welcome to our educational podcast episode where we explore an important question: Can your genetic code reveal ways to prevent diabetes? Our genetics play a significant role in our health, particularly concerning conditions like diabetes. It’s not just about diet and exercise; your genetic makeup can influence your risk of developing diabetes.

Studies have shown that certain genetic markers can heighten this risk, especially those related to insulin production and glucose metabolism. Many people are unaware that they might carry genetic variants that could make them more susceptible to diabetes. For instance, the MTHFR gene affects how your body processes folate and regulates homocysteine levels. Higher homocysteine levels have been linked to insulin resistance and type 2 diabetes. Understanding your genetic profile can empower you to make lifestyle choices that help mitigate these risks.

Once you receive your genetic test results, it’s crucial to analyze them and integrate that information into your daily life. Here are a few strategies you might consider:

Personalized Nutrition: Your genetic predisposition can guide you in selecting foods that meet your specific nutritional needs. If your results indicate a higher risk for insulin resistance, you might benefit from a low-carb diet rich in whole foods.

Targeted Exercise Plans: Your body’s response to different types of exercise can vary based on your genetics. With genetic testing, you can tailor your fitness routine to maximize your diabetes prevention efforts.

Early Intervention: If your genetic test suggests an increased risk for diabetes, healthcare providers can help you establish preventive measures, such as regular blood sugar monitoring and lifestyle changes.

So, what’s next after receiving your results? Here are some practical tips to make the most of your genetic insights:

  1. Consult with a healthcare provider. They can help you interpret your results and create a personalized prevention strategy.
  2. Adopt a balanced diet. Focus on whole foods—f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and healthy fats—while cutting down on processed foods and sugars.
  3. Stay active!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ate exercise each week, combining aerobic workouts with strength training.
  4. Monitor your health regularly. Keeping an eye on your blood sugar levels is essential, especially if you have a genetic predisposition to diabetes.
  5. Educate yourself about diabetes and its risk factors. The more you know, the better choices you can make for your health.
